0.0.1 • Published 2 years ago
@goplugin/test v0.0.1
Chainlink Smart Contracts
Installation
# via pnpm
$ pnpm add @goplugin/contractsv2
# via npm
$ npm install @goplugin/contractsv2 --saveDirectory Structure
@goplugin/contracts
├── src # Solidity contracts
│ ├── v0.4
│ ├── v0.5
│ ├── v0.6
│ ├── v0.7
│ └── v0.8
└── abi # ABI json output
├── v0.4
├── v0.5
├── v0.6
├── v0.7
└── v0.8Usage
The solidity smart contracts themselves can be imported via the src directory of @chainlink/contracts:
import '@goplugin/contracts/src/v0.8/AutomationCompatibleInterface.sol';Local Development
Note: Contracts in dev/ directories are under active development and are likely unaudited. Please refrain from using these in production applications.
# Clone Chainlink repository
$ git clone https://github.com/goplugin/pluginV2.git
# Continuing via pnpm
$ cd contracts/
$ pnpm
$ pnpm testContributing
Please try to adhere to Solidity Style Guide.
Contributions are welcome! Please refer to Plugin's contributing guidelines for detailed contribution information.
Thank you!
License
0.0.1
2 years ago